#ifndef _COMPAT_SYS_SIGNAL_H_
#define _COMPAT_SYS_SIGNAL_H_

#include <compat/sys/sigtypes.h>

#if defined(_NETBSD_SOURCE)

/* Number of signals supported by old style signal mask. */
#define NSIG13          32

#endif /* _NETBSD_SOURCE */

#if defined(_POSIX_C_SOURCE) || defined(_XOPEN_SOURCE) || \
    defined(_NETBSD_SOURCE)
/*
 * Signal vector "template" used in sigaction call.
 */
struct  sigaction13 {
        void    (*osa_handler)          /* signal handler */
                           (int);
        sigset13_t osa_mask;            /* signal mask to apply */
        int     osa_flags;              /* see signal options below */
};
#endif

#if defined(_NETBSD_SOURCE)
/*
 * 4.3 compatibility:
 * Signal vector "template" used in sigvec call.
 */
struct  sigvec {
        void    (*sv_handler)           /* signal handler */
                           (int);
        int     sv_mask;                /* signal mask to apply */
        int     sv_flags;               /* see signal options below */
};
#define SV_ONSTACK      SA_ONSTACK
#define SV_INTERRUPT    SA_RESTART      /* same bit, opposite sense */
#define SV_RESETHAND    SA_RESETHAND
#define sv_onstack sv_flags     /* isn't compatibility wonderful! */

#ifndef _KERNEL
__BEGIN_DECLS
int sigvec(int, struct sigvec *, struct sigvec *);
__END_DECLS
#endif

#endif /* _NETBSD_SOURCE */

#endif  /* !_COMPAT_SYS_SIGNAL_H_ */
